Karur is the administrative headquarters of Karur District in the South Indian state of Tamil Nadu. Karur is the district formed after independence and Located on the banks of River Amaravathi and River Kaveri, it has been ruled, at different times, by the Chera, Vijayanagar Empire, Madurai Nayaks, Hyder Ali, Carnatic kingdom, and the British. It is located at a distance of 420 kilometres (261 mi) southwest of the state capital Chennai. Karur is the district located "HEART" of Tamil Nadu. i.e Karur is centre of Tamil Nadu and equally distance to all around Tamil Nadu districts & quick reach by Road ways. It is well worldwide known for Hand looms, Power loom textile products, TN Govt undertaken Paper factory TNPL, Chettinad Cement Factory, EID Parry Sugar factory and World wide exports of Bus body building work industries.The leading private rating banks Karur Vysya Bank commonly called KVB and Lakshmi Vilas Bank commonly called LVB have their headquarters (H.Q) in Karur.

Karur is a part of Karur constituency and elects its member of legislative assembly every five years, and a part of the Karur constituency that elects its member of parliament. The town is administered by a municipality established in 1874 as per the Municipal Corporation Act. The town covers an area of 10.96 km2 (4.23 sq mi) and had a population of 2,62,570 peoples. Roadways are the major mode of transportation to the town, but Karur also has rail connectivity. The nearest airport is Tiruchirapalli International Airport, located 77 km (48 mi) east from Karur.

It is mentioned in inscriptions and literature by two names, Karuvoor and Vanji. It had other names too: Adipuram, Tiruaanilai, Paupatheechuram, Karuvaippatinam, Vanjularanyam, Garbhapuram, Thiru vithuvakkottam, Bhaskarapuram, Mudivazhangu Viracholapuram, Karapuram, Aadaga maadam, Cherama nagar and Shanmangala Kshetram. Among them, the name Adipuram, meaning the first city seems to indicate that it was held as the foremost city by the medieval writers. It was also called Vanci moothur, the ancient city of Vanji. In the foreign notices of Ptolemy, it was called Karoura - an inland capital of the Cheras.
